Front Access – Access to Power Bus

1. Complete the Power Lock-out Procedure (refer to

Power Lock-out

Procedure on page 47 of Chapter 5

) for both Medium Voltage power cells

and that power bar.

2. Open medium voltage power cell door (see

Figure 29

).

Figure 29 - ArcShield Power Cell (Upper)

3. Remove the retaining screw from the cable duct barrier and remove the

barrier (see

Figure 30

).

4. Remove the two retaining screws from the cable duct boot and remove the

boot (see

Figure 30

).

ATTENTION: To avoid shock hazards, lock out incoming power (refer to

Power

Lock-out Procedure on page 47 of Chapter 5

) before working on the equipment.

Verify with a hot stick or appropriate voltage measuring device that all circuits
are voltage free. Failure to do so may result in severe burns, injury or death.
